Cannondale Moterra Neo Carbon 1: High quality e-fully available
For all cyclists who appreciate rough terrain, Cannondale offers a new model. The Cannondale Moterra Neo Carbon relies on high-quality equipment and a chic design, but is anything but a bargain.
The Cannondale Moterra Neo Carbon 1 in detail
The e-fully Cannondale Moterra Neo relies on a particularly lightweight and robust carbon frame and comes with high-quality equipment. A Bosch Performance Line CX Smart mid-motor delivers 250 watts of power and accelerates the e-bike up to 25 km/h.
The drive comes mostly from Shimano, who contribute a 12-speed XT chain and at the same time the 203 mm Shimano XT 8120 disc brakes. High-quality RockShox Deluxe Select+ shocks with adjustable rebound and a 150 mm suspension front and rear should ensure a comfortable ride even in rough terrain.
Also on offer is a Bosch Kiox display, while 29-inch Maxxis Minion DHF tires are used. In front there is even a Lezyne Super HB STVZO E1000 lighting including high beam.
750 Wh strong battery
Another highlight of the Cannondale Moterra Neo Carbon 1 is the battery from Bosch, which brings a capacity of 750 watt hours. It can be conveniently removed and charged at home.
The manufacturer does not provide details about the range, but the pure capacity indicates that the e-bike will probably not run out of steam very quickly.
Around 25 kg dead weight brings the E-Fully on the scale and offers a permissible total weight of 150 kg – driver/rider and possible luggage may bring along thus only maximally 125 kg.

Price and availability
The Cannondale Moterra Neo Carbon 1 e-fully is now available in stores. However, the recommended retail price of 7,999 euros has it in itself. First dealers, such as Fahrrad XXL, however, list the e-bike for 7,499.99 euros.
